The Core Appeal: Cluster Pays and Rapid Cascades
Instead of traditional paylines, Sugar Rush 1000 relies on clusters of five or more identical symbols that must touch horizontally or vertically. When a cluster breaks, it disappears and new symbols tumble in from above—so one spin can produce several payouts.
- Cluster size matters: larger clusters pay bigger.
- Every tumble offers another chance for a win.
- The chance of a cluster keeps the pace brisk.
For the player who thrives on quick outcomes, this means you can see a win almost immediately after the grid resets.

Multiplier Spots: Building Momentum Fast
The multiplier system is where Sugar Rush 1000 can feel explosive. Each time a winning cluster lands on a specific grid spot, that spot receives a multiplier that starts at ×2 and doubles with each subsequent win in the same spot—up to ×1,024.
How Multipliers Stack
If two separate clusters hit the same spot during one tumble sequence, their multipliers combine additively rather than multiplicatively.
- Example: First win at spot A gives ×2.
- Second win at spot A adds another ×2 → total ×4.
- Third win adds another ×4 → total ×8.
Because the multiplier stays active throughout a free spin round, you can see dramatic increases quickly—perfect for players who want instant escalation.
Free Spins: The Quick‑Fire Reward
Scattering three or more Gumball Machine symbols opens the free spins feature. The faster you trigger it, the more chances you get to reap the multiplier bonuses that linger on the grid.
How Many Spins Do You Get?
- 3 scatters = 10 free spins
- 4 scatters = 12 free spins
- 5 scatters = 15 free spins
- 6 scatters = 20 free spins
- 7 scatters = 30 free spins
The key for short‑session players is to aim for at least five scatters; that gives enough spins to test the multiplier stack without over‑extending the session.
The Bonus Buy: A Quick Shortcut?
Feeling impatient? You can purchase entry into the free spins round outright. Two options exist:
- Standard Free Spins: Pay 100× your current bet to trigger normal free spins.
- Super Free Spins: Pay 500× your bet and start with multipliers already set to at least ×2.
The Super Free Spins option can feel like an instant power‑up for those who want an immediate high‑risk payoff. However, players who stick to short bursts should weigh whether the extra cost fits into their limited session budget.
Symbol Payouts That Keep You Hooked
The game’s candy symbols pay out differently depending on cluster size.
- Pink Lollipop – up to 150× for large clusters (15+).
- Heart Candy – up to 100×.
- Jelly Bean – up to 60×.
- Star Candy – up to 40×.
- Red Gummy Bear – up to 30×.
- Purple Gummy Bear – up to 25×.
- Orange Gummy Bear – up to 20×.
The higher payouts are usually triggered when clusters are large or when multipliers stack—so keep an eye on those big groups during your fast play.
